


Analogue - The conventional method of time display via hands on a dial
Digital - Time is displayed by a series of digits
Anidigi - A mixture of analogue and digital display
Chrono - An analogue display with sub dials used for timing
Chronograph means that this watch has stopwatch functions.
Quartz - This watch is powered by a long life battery.
Swiss Quartz - This watch was manufactured in Switzerland to exact Swiss standards and is powered by a long life battery.
Automatic - This watch is powered by the movement of your wrist. The movement winds the main spring which in turn unwinds slowly to power the watch.

A bold, statement and striking Casio watch, this heavy duty style unisex design features a carbon coated stainless steel case and a carbon coated stainless steel bracelet strap. The round dial is black with white, green and yellow accents, has three hand movement, sub dial chronograph and also features digital readings.
An electro-luminescent panel causes the entire face to glow for easy reading. Auto Light automatically turns on the EL backlight when the watch is tilted towards your face for reading.
A luminous coating provides long-term illumination in the dark after only a short exposure to light.
A sensor measures the ambient temperature around the watch and displays it in °C (-10°C /+60°C).
Displays the current time in major cities and specific areas around the world.
Measures with an accuracy of seconds the meantime and the end time. Signals confirm the starting/stop selection. The measuring capacity reaches up to 100 hours.
Up to 50 items of data comprising the date and lap times can be stored here for later retrieval.
For fans of precision: the countdown timers help you to remember specific or recurring events by giving off an audible signal at a preset time. They then count back automatically from the preset time. The time can be set to the nearest second and up to 100 hours in advance. Ideal for people who need to take medicines every day or those who do interval training.
The daily alarm sounds each day at the time you set. The value indicates how many daily alarms are available. The hourly time signal causes the watch to beep every hour on the hour.
The key tones can be turned off as and when required using the mode button. This therefore means that the watch no longer beeps when switching from one function to another. Preset alarm or countdown timers remain active when the key tones are deactivated.
One battery will supply your watch with the power it needs for about 3 years.
Allowances are made automatically for months of different lengths, in case date corrections for leap years are required.
Times can be displayed in either a 12-hour or 24-hour format.
Hard glass resists scratching.
The surface of the glass is rounded.
Always reliable: This watch has a particularly secure safety catch, which helps prevent the strap from opening by mistake.
Perfect for swimming and snorkelling: the watch is water resistant to 10 bar / 100 metres. The metres value does not relate to a diving depth but to the air pressure used in the course of the water resistance test. (ISO 2281)
